Student Population Changes

The average student population over the last 12 years is 7,386 where 2,603 students are attending the school for the academic year 2022-2023.
85.90% of total students is undergraduate students and 14.10% students is graduate students. The number of undergraduate students has decreased by 8,867 and the graduate enrollment has decreased by 4,110 over past 10 years.
The female to male ratio is 1.91 to 1 and it means that there are more female students enrolled in IWU than male students.

Enrollment by Race/Ethnicity Changes

The percentage of white students is 80.14%. The percentage was 75.39% 10 years ago and IWU still has a high percentage of white students. 2.11% of enrolled students is Asian and 6.07% is black students.

Distance Learning (Online Courses) Enrollment Changes

306 students are enrolled in online degree programs exclusively for the academic year 2022-2023, which is 12% of total students. The number of online students has decreased -95.91% since 2014.
